首页
首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
react组件积累
慕仲卿
创建于2023-10-10
订阅专栏
积累一些平时我手写/封装的组件,方便下次使用
等 40 人订阅
共76篇文章
创建于2023-10-10
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
大型React前端工程基础配置实践片 -- 麦帅也觉得很赞
在实际的工程开发中,为了提高开发效率、优化用户体验,我们通常会配置一些基础设置。本文将介绍如何进行大型React前端工程的基础配置实践。
React组件 -- Tabs封装
本文介绍了一种封装antd的Tab组件的方法。通过对antd的Tab组件的封装,可以让我们更加聚焦在每个页面的逻辑构造上,从而提高开发效率。
React组件 -- echarts封装
本文对一段代码进行解析,这段代码是一个基于React和echarts的图表组件,通过封装echarts的相关功能和组件,实现了一个自定义的图表组件。
react组件 -- 前端路由
react组件 -- 前端路由 本文介绍了一些关于react开发前端项目的时候,使用前端路由组件相关的知识点,希望能够对有此需求的小伙伴有所帮助和启发~
关于前端路由跳转的一些深层次思考
最近笔者在进行一个electron项目的架构改动,在改动的过程中对electron内涵的前端项目中的路由跳转做了一些个人的思考,下面将思考的结果以问答的形式整理出来,希望能够对您有所帮助!
类组件转函数式组件总结
将类组件改造为函数式组件时,可以使用React钩子(Hooks)来替代类组件的生命周期钩子方法。通过使用useState、useEffect和其他自定义钩子,可以实现与类组件相似的功能。
React组件 -- 手把手教你构建一个Form表
本文旨在记录React开发过程中通用表格的构造,本文的目的是为了手把手的教会React入门的同学构建自己的Form表单,也为了以后自己复用起来方便。如果你觉得不错或者有所收获的话,还望不惜赐赞!
项目级WebSocket客户端工厂类设计详解及技巧总结
WebSocket客户端工厂类是一个用于管理和控制WebSocket连接的实用工具。本文将详细介绍它的设计思路以及包含的属性和方法。
React组件 -- 文字省略提示
在Web开发中,我们经常会遇到需要显示提示信息的场景,比如当鼠标悬停在一个元素上时,显示该元素的详细说明。为了实现这样的功能,我们可以使用React来创建一个TooltipWrapper组件。
React组件封装 -- 弹出对话框
封装一个函数式组件实现前端开发中经常遇到的场景: 点击按钮弹出对话框。此组件可以作为一个模板,具备弹窗的基本功能,遵循基于构件开发的设计原则。
函数式组件 -- 时间显示
本文通过构建TimerC组件,可以将多个时间计算组件TimeComponent实例化并渲染到指定的容器中。这样,就完成了整个前端界面时间的统一管理和更新。
函数式组件 -- 触发锁屏
在前端开发中,常常需要实现锁屏功能;最为常见的情况为点击某个按钮进入锁屏。本文从实际业务出发,从已经实现的锁屏功能中抽取出锁屏功能模板,从功能实现和注意细节两个角度进行说明,实现后续开发过程中的复用
函数式组件 -- iframe封装
随着前端项目业务复杂程度的不断提高,需要将一些第三方的功能模块接入系统中;因此,在实际开发的时候,常常使用iframe将这些第三方模块集成进来。现封装一个Iframe函数式组件,以实现后续的复用。
一种分离React组件内外部方法的架构
介绍一种比较新颖的架构方法,实现对React组件内外部方法的分离; - 外部方法:提供给组件外部对象调用的方法,在内部永远也不会用到 - 作用:向外提供了操作此组件的接口;使组件的结构更加清晰
使用window对象传递消息
随着前端业务逻辑的愈发复杂化,常需要在不同窗口之间进行数据通信,本文介绍了如何使用message事件进行数据通信的行为。
函数式组件 -- 缩略图
在日常前端开发的过程中,我不止一次的遇到过主视图-缩略图功能的实现。现封装一个组件,将其渲染到不同的位置上去,实现主视图和缩略图的功能,同时提供了接口,保留了一定的定制化功能
函数式组件 -- IconFont
封装了一个iconFont的组件,方便之后的工作中进行使用;此组件提供了大量的接口,可以较为自由的根据业务场景进行配置。
函数式组件 -- ColorPicker (但具有历史记录功能)
封装了一个用来选择颜色的react函数式组件ColorPicker,使用自定义钩子函数,利用useState和localStorage实现记录选中颜色历史功能。